    Montage is a good name for an L.A. Four recording, because the group (Bud Shank on flute and alto, guitarist Laurindo Almeida, bassist Ray Brown and drummer Jeff Hamilton) consistently mixed together different elements to gain its own sound. Included on this date are classical themes by Claude Debussy and Heitor Villa-Lobos, three group originals (including Shank's "Madame Butterball"), "Teach Me Tonight" (taken as a samba), and cooking renditions of "My Romance" and "Squatty Roo." A fine example of the L.A. Four's unique yet very accessible music. - All Music Guide

    This is the recording of the show at Brixton Academy on 23rd December 1987. It was one of the shows that were recorded for a new live album. Instead the show at the Rock of Giants festival in Finland was chosen and this recording was shelved for six years before it was released by Roadrunner for the first time in 1994 as "Live At Brixton" (Not to be confused with "Boneshaker: Live At Brixton Academy" - the latter an audio-visual documentation of Motorhead's 25th anniversary concert that took place at the same venue in 2000). "Live At Brixton" shows once again, that the Motormachine is never more brutal than when it's in the live environment.

    Vicente Amigo reveals the ins and outs of his fifth “journey in sound”, a record up to the expectations built up over five years. The Córdoba-born guitarist wants to get across “a new message”, without losing that personality which has boosted him to the big leagues of flamenco guitar. Although the album deserves an in-depth musical analysis, it also allows a reading for all audiences. And the thing is that the complexity contained in the guitarist’s new creation is miraculously not incompatible with its understanding. Quite to the contrary, it has well-flowing, catchy tracks such as the rumba ‘Demipatí’, ‘Tangos del Arco Bajo’ and even the zapateado ‘Oriente mediterráneo’.
    And at the other end, as the author himself points out, experiments like the farruca ‘Silia y el tiempo’ and the taranta ‘Un momento en el sonido’. Both scores display a new way of balancing brain, sensitivity and fingers. Even in compositions which apparently stick to the norm, details of unusual subtlety and exquisiteness are concealed. Therefore, take note of the soleá ‘Mezquita’.
    The naturalness of the sound, the flow and proximity of the guitar’s sound on this album must also be pointed out. No abrupt mixing or loud choruses… the voices are touches, the instruments surrounding the guitar do just that; surround it, embellish. Like the nostalgic air of the farruca strengthened by Ariel Hernández’s concertina, like the high-energy beat of Tino di Geraldo’s drums which keeps the rumba going. Generally speaking, there’s contention and taste, space and light… and, in case there are any doubts, flamencura in torrents. It’s clear that the time has come for the changing of the guard with this album. -

    The time for their roads to come together again has arrived. It was a pending matter for Vicente Amigo and El Pele to cross paths. And they have done so at a geodesic point called ‘Canto’, twelve years after having separated their professional careers. With their hearts as a source of complicity, the Córdoba-born guitarist and cantaor share their art with universalizing intentions, wishing to turn into extroverted the introverted. Neither borders, nor labels, nor hieroglyphics… but rather depth, legibility, soul, transcendence. And they say so themselves, proud of having conceived and developed a record “at the same level as any pop, rock, jazz, or whatever star, because it might be flamenco, but it’s an awesome album no matter where you play it”. -

    A selection of classic love songs sung by one of the greatest singers in the history of jazz. Billie Holiday is accompanied by a galaxy of star jazzmen of the Swing Era, heard afresh in new digital transfers from the original 78rpm disc masters, reproduced for the first time, with stunning clarity, in compatible stereo/surround sound. Featuring:Tony Wilson, Roy Eldridge, Ben Webster, Chu Berry, Lester Young, Buck Clayton et al.
